Episode 52. - Albert Hammond
from WAT Met Willim Welsyn Podcast · host Willim Welsyn
The legendary songsmith Albert Hammond is heading to South Africa to perform in Cape Town at the Artscape Operahouse on the 14th of April and in Johannesburg at the Teatro Montecasino on the 16th of April. Willim calls him in New York prior to his departure to discuss his jam-packed world tour, the mystery behind his songwriting success and his initial involvement with The Strokes’ debut album Is This It – for whom his son Albert Hammond Jnr. plays guitar.
